Transaction 4495921960f361c54661a34d189605b829dd3178858d919442ae270142ad99e4
1 Input
1 Output
-
4495921960f361c54661a34d189605b829dd3178858d919442ae270142ad99e4:0
- value
- 137668391
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d177499e47cc54957009326f13e6d38ca8facab
- address
- bc1qd5thfx0y0nz5j4cqjvn0z0nd8r9glt9t85dpu9